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Marsden (Yorks) to East Didsbury start from as little as £7.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Marsden (Yorks) to East Didsbury are available for £16.20 one way, or £20.80 return

Station Facilities and Services

Though Marsden (Yorks) station may not boast a ticket office, it offers modern conveniences for ticket collection and purchase. Ticket machines are readily available to assist passengers with their travel arrangements. Furthermore, the station embraces accessibility, providing induction loops and accessible ticket machines to ensure everyone can manage their travel needs seamlessly.

Despite the absence of station staff, help is never far away. Passengers can rely on customer help points as well as a dedicated helpline to address any concerns they might have. It's important to note, however, that the station does not have CCTV,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ities, so it may be worth planning ahead if you're in need of such amenities during your stop.

Transportation Connectivity

For those looking to continue their journey from Marsden, the station is well-integrated with alternative transport options. A rail replacement service is conveniently located by the station car park, ensuring smooth transitions even when train services are disrupted. Marsden is well-connected with local bus services, with Busline available at 0871 200 2233 for up-to-date travel information. For taxi services, you can book with ease through Cab4You, enhancing your onward travel options.

Facilities and Ticketing

East Didsbury is equipped with essentials to ensure your travel is smooth. The station features a ticket office that operates during the morning hours from Monday to Saturday, allowing you to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ets conveniently. There are also ticket machines available for those outside these hours, including accessible machines for those with limited mobility. While there aren't any refreshment facilities on site, the seamless ticketing process will get you on your way without fuss.

Accessibility and Support Services

The station strives to provide an inclusive experience with some level of step-free access and accessible ticket machines. For assistance, staff are available to help during the morning hours on weekdays and Saturdays. Additionally, ramp access ensures ease for those needing it to board trains. While amenities like secure bicycle storage, wheelchairs, or waiting rooms are not available, customer help points ensure assistance is never too far away.

Travel Connections and Options

Need to continue your journey beyond the rails? East Didsbury offers several transport connections that link you conveniently to your next stop. Buses to Manchester Piccadilly run frequently, with stops clearly marked opposite the cinema on Wilmslow Road. For taxi services, you can visit Cab4You for more details, making it easy to book your ride. Bus services extend to areas like Stockport, Altrincham, and more, ensuring you can reach your destination without a hitch.
